The first winner of the Barclays Community Icon of the Month award has been announced.
What is the Barclays Community Icon of the Month award?
This new initiative celebrates individuals who have made a meaningful impact through Premier League-funded programmes.
At the start of the season, clubs were invited to nominate standout volunteers or participants for their positive contributions, and each month, one winner will be spotlighted through a short video that brings their inspiring story to life.
Fulham's Shai wins first award
Shai Ivey's journey began with the Premier League Kicks programme and he has come full circle through the Made in Fulham project, supported by the Premier League and Professional Footballers’ Association Community Fund.
Shai has been recognised for his dedication, teamwork and leadership, and is described by staff as a truly inspiring figure – both to those who support him and those he now supports.

"It means a lot to me, because it feels like I can be a role model for others in the future and the younger generation," Shai said.
"I want them to make the most of the opportunities that I did and take the opportunities that I might have missed.
"The expectation was just to play football every week, but now I look at how I can influence the younger generation and how I can impact the community in positive ways.
"To begin with, I was quite happy to go through the motions, whereas now I want to make the most of everything, especially while I am young, and I would advise others to do the same."
Shai is now a qualified coach, set to work on Fulham FC Foundation programmes – including Kicks, the sessions where his journey began five years ago.
